Mind Pilot Episode 18

Dive deep into the misunderstood realm of dissociation with Dr. Jana Price-Sharps in this riveting episode of Mind Pilot. Discover the spectrum of dissociative responses, from everyday moments of 'checking out' to severe trauma-induced reactions, and learn why even the most resilient individuals, like first responders, are susceptible. This episode not only explores the brain's protective mechanisms but also addresses the potentially life-altering decisions that stem from unchecked dissociation. Tune in to grasp how sleep and confronting past traumas can be pivotal in healing and staying present. Whether you're in law enforcement, emergency services, or simply coping with the stresses of life, this is a conversation about mental health you can't afford to miss.

Topics covered:

  • UNDERSTANDING DISSOCIATION: Dr. Jana Price-Sharps breaks down the complexity of dissociative identity disorder (DID) and explains the lesser-known, everyday dissociative responses that can impact our lives.
  • FIRST RESPONDERS' MENTAL HEALTH: Insights into how constant exposure to trauma can lead to dissociative states in first responders, affecting their connection to the present and leading to poor decision-making.
  • STRATEGIES FOR COPING: Practical advice on how addressing recent stresses, prioritizing sleep, and engaging in trauma-informed therapy can mitigate dissociative episodes and promote mental well-being.
